"The biggest scam in town-- but by no means the only-- is the 'pay for play' practices of office-holders at every level. Of course, not all public servants are guilty-- most are not. However, Ohio Republicans have held every statewide office since 1994, and the governorship and secretary of state since 1990. They currently have long-standing, lopsided majorities in both houses of the general assembly. The endemic culture of money-for-influence is a testament to the corrupting consequences that inevitably follow when one party holds power for too long."
Kasich goes on to lay out a convincing case against the Republican Party. "Exhibit A in this mire is Toledo coin dealer and Republican fundraiser Tom Noe. His 'coingate' scandal, as it has been inelegantly termed, demonstrated a total breakdown in ethics and was a direct result of one-party domination of the political process. Mr. Noe obtained several contracts totaling some $50 million to pursue investment opportunities for the Ohio Bureau of Workers Compensation, in this case rare coin speculation. With limited oversight of his operation, Mr. Noe allegedly began laundering campaign contributions to state and federal candidates (including President Bush). In February Mr. Noe was indicted on 53 felony counts and faces a mandatory 10-year prison term if convicted of corruption. At this point $10 million to $12 million remains unaccounted for. Unfortunately, coingate isn't the only prominent Republican scandal."
